Cybersecurity and Cryptography

study guides for every class

that actually explain what's on your next test

OWASP Top Ten

from class:

Cybersecurity and Cryptography

Definition

The OWASP Top Ten is a regularly-updated report outlining the ten most critical security risks facing web applications. This resource serves as a foundational guideline for developers and organizations to enhance their security posture by addressing the most prevalent vulnerabilities. It connects to secure software development practices, emphasizing the need for integrating security measures throughout the development lifecycle, adhering to secure coding standards, understanding web application architecture risks, and fostering ethical hacking approaches to improve software security.

congrats on reading the definition of OWASP Top Ten.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. The OWASP Top Ten project was first published in 2003 and has evolved over the years to reflect the changing landscape of web application security threats.
  2. Each entry in the OWASP Top Ten includes a description of the vulnerability, potential impact, and guidance on how to mitigate the risk effectively.
  3. The list is not just for developers but also serves as a valuable resource for security professionals and organizations looking to strengthen their overall security strategy.
  4. Regularly reviewing and implementing the OWASP Top Ten can significantly reduce an organization's attack surface by addressing common vulnerabilities.
  5. The OWASP Top Ten is recognized globally and is often referenced in compliance frameworks and security standards as a benchmark for application security.

Review Questions

  • How does the OWASP Top Ten contribute to secure software development practices?
    • The OWASP Top Ten acts as a critical reference point for secure software development by identifying the most common vulnerabilities that web applications face. By integrating these findings into the development lifecycle, developers can proactively address these risks during design, coding, testing, and deployment phases. This ensures that security is not an afterthought but a fundamental part of creating secure applications.
  • Discuss the role of the OWASP Top Ten in promoting ethical hacking and responsible disclosure within organizations.
    • The OWASP Top Ten fosters an environment where ethical hacking can thrive by providing clear guidelines on vulnerabilities that need attention. Security professionals and ethical hackers can use this list to focus their testing efforts on high-risk areas. Additionally, responsible disclosure processes can be informed by understanding these vulnerabilities, helping organizations react promptly and effectively when issues are found.
  • Evaluate the importance of continuously updating and reviewing the OWASP Top Ten in light of evolving web application threats.
    • Continuously updating and reviewing the OWASP Top Ten is essential because web application threats are constantly evolving due to new attack techniques and technologies. By regularly reassessing this list, organizations can ensure they are addressing current vulnerabilities that pose the greatest risk to their systems. This dynamic approach allows businesses to adapt their security strategies effectively, staying ahead of potential threats and protecting sensitive data from exploitation.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ides